18. Baywatch

Such is the obsession with old projects from the past that the film industry has now arrived at multiple reboots of a property whose first reboot didn't quite pan out the way as was hoped. Seriously, at what point is defeat admitted?

Baywatch was an incredibly popular and iconic TV series, but was a product of its era, with projects now needing more than annoyingly good looking people running across the beach in slow motion. As such, the 2017 reboot with Dwayne Johnson and Zac Efron, two of the most annoyingly good looking people out there, fell flat on its face.

So, is the property left to rest? No! Surely a rebooted TV series, with more direct ties to the original will work right? That's what seems to be the thought process behind the new Baywatch take, that will see Mitch Buchanan's (David Hasselhoff) son appear in the form of Stephen Amell.

David Chokachi has also been cast, reprising his role as Cody Madison from the original series as something of a mentor for Amell's Hobie. Of course, anything could happen, and the show could turn into an absolute smash hit, but at this point it does feel more like flogging a dead horse than getting back on it.
